Introduction: AI Knowledge Is Not Enough—Business Value Is the Real Opportunity

Artificial Intelligence is transforming the way organizations work, compete, communicate, market, sell, and serve customers.

In 2026, many businesses have access to AI tools.

But access to technology does not automatically create business value.

Business owners and organizational leaders often face important questions:

  • Where should we use AI?

  • Which business problems should we solve first?

  • Which AI tools are appropriate?

  • How can AI improve productivity?

  • What are the risks?

  • How can employees adopt AI successfully?

  • How should success be measured?

This is where the role of an AI Business Consultant becomes important.

An AI Business Consultant helps organizations identify business problems, evaluate AI opportunities, design practical solutions, support implementation, manage adoption, and measure outcomes.

The most successful consultant is not necessarily the person who knows the most AI terminology.

The real professional advantage comes from combining:

AI + Business Understanding + Data + Strategy + Communication + Implementation + Responsible Judgment

This complete guide explains how aspiring professionals can build the knowledge, portfolio, credibility, and consulting capabilities needed to pursue AI business consulting in 2026.


What Is an AI Business Consultant?

An AI Business Consultant acts as a bridge between:

Business Problems

and

AI-Powered Solutions

The role may include:

  • AI opportunity assessment

  • Business-process analysis

  • AI strategy

  • Workflow automation

  • Generative AI adoption

  • AI agent evaluation

  • Data-readiness assessment

  • Vendor and tool evaluation

  • Employee training

  • Change management

  • Responsible AI guidance

  • Performance measurement

The consultant's responsibility is not simply to say:

"Use AI."

A stronger professional question is:

"What business problem are we solving, and is AI the appropriate solution?"

Step 7: Learn Process Mapping

Before recommending AI, understand the current workflow.

Ask:

  1. What happens now?

  2. Who performs the work?

  3. Where are delays occurring?

  4. Which tasks are repetitive?

  5. What information is required?

  6. What risks exist?

  7. Where can AI genuinely help?

A simple workflow might be:

Lead → Research → Contact → Qualification → Proposal → Follow-Up → Customer

AI may support selected stages.

But automation should not be implemented merely because it is technically possible.

Step 10: Understand RAG and Knowledge Systems

Retrieval-Augmented Generation, often called RAG, can help AI systems use relevant organizational information.

Learn the basic concepts:

  • Documents

  • Retrieval

  • Embeddings

  • Vector search

  • Context

  • Evaluation

A consultant should be able to ask:

Does this organization need a general chatbot, or a controlled knowledge system connected to approved information?


Step 11: Learn AI Agents Carefully

AI agents are increasingly discussed as tools for performing multi-step tasks.

Potential uses may include:

  • Research workflows

  • Information processing

  • Task coordination

  • Customer support assistance

However, autonomy creates additional risks.

Consider:

  • Permissions

  • Human approval

  • Security

  • Error handling

  • Monitoring

  • Cost control

The professional principle is:

More autonomy requires more thoughtful governance.

Step 13: Learn ROI and Business Value

Clients usually do not purchase AI because a technology is fashionable.

They want to understand potential value.

Possible measurements include:

  • Time saved

  • Costs reduced

  • Revenue supported

  • Errors reduced

  • Customer response time

  • Employee productivity

  • Process efficiency

Be careful with predictions.

Do not promise results that cannot be reasonably supported.

Use:

Hypothesis → Pilot → Measurement → Improvement

How to Price AI Consulting Services

Pricing depends on:

  • Experience

  • Project complexity

  • Client size

  • Risk

  • Required expertise

  • Scope

  • Expected value

Possible approaches include:

Hourly Pricing

Useful for some advisory work.

Project Pricing

Useful for clearly defined deliverables.

Retainer

Useful for ongoing support.

Value- or Outcome-Linked Components

May be appropriate in some situations, but require careful definition of success and consideration of factors outside the consultant's control.

Recent discussion in the consulting industry suggests that AI-driven efficiency is also challenging traditional time-based consulting models. (Business Insider)

Never guarantee a specific financial result.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Mistake 1: Learning Tools Without Learning Business

Tools change.

Business problems remain.


Mistake 2: Collecting Certificates Without Building Projects

Evidence of practical capability matters.


Mistake 3: Promising Impossible Results

Be realistic and transparent.


Mistake 4: Ignoring Data and Privacy

Responsible AI requires appropriate safeguards.


Mistake 5: Automating a Broken Process

First understand the process.

Then improve it.

Then automate where appropriate.


Mistake 6: Trying to Serve Everyone

Specialization can improve clarity.


Mistake 7: Forgetting Human Adoption

Technology fails when people do not understand or adopt it.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What does an AI Business Consultant do?

An AI Business Consultant helps organizations identify business opportunities, evaluate AI use cases, develop strategies, support implementation, and measure outcomes.


2. Do I need a computer science degree?

Not necessarily. The requirements vary by role. A strong consulting career can combine AI literacy, domain knowledge, business skills, and practical experience.


3. Is coding mandatory?

Not for every AI business consulting role. However, basic technical literacy can improve your ability to communicate with technical teams and evaluate solutions.


4. What is the best skill for an AI consultant?

There is no single best skill. A powerful combination includes:

Problem-Solving + AI Literacy + Business Understanding + Communication.


5. How long does it take to become an AI Business Consultant?

The timeline varies based on your existing experience. Building meaningful practical capability takes sustained learning and project experience.


6. Can beginners become AI consultants?

Beginners can start building relevant skills and projects. However, professional consulting requires the ability to provide responsible and valuable guidance.


7. Should I learn prompt engineering?

Yes. Understanding how to communicate effectively with AI systems can be useful, but prompt engineering alone is not sufficient for business consulting.


8. Can AI consultants work with small businesses?

Yes. Small businesses may benefit from practical support with workflow improvement, marketing, customer communication, and productivity—subject to their specific needs and resources.


9. How can I get my first AI consulting client?

Build practical projects, develop a focused offer, demonstrate useful knowledge, network professionally, and begin with clearly scoped work.


10. Can AI consulting guarantee financial freedom?

No. AI consulting can create opportunities, but income and financial outcomes depend on many factors and cannot be guaranteed.
